HASSETT v. WELCH

No. 375.

303 U.S. 303 (1938)

HASSETT, FORMER ACTING COLLECTOR, v. WELCH ET AL., EXECUTORS.

Supreme Court of United States.

Decided February 28, 1938.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Assistant Attorney General Morris, with whom Solicitor General Reed, and Messrs. Sewall Key and Arnold Raum were on the briefs, for petitioners.

Mr. William D. Mitchell, with whom Messrs. James Lenox Banks, Jr., and George H. Craven were on the brief, for respondent in No. 484.

Messrs. John L. Hall and Claude R. Branch, with whom Messrs. Henry Hixon Meyer and Edward C. Thayer were on the brief, for respondents in No. 375.


MR. JUSTICE ROBERTS delivered the opinion of the Court.

The petitioners ask us to hold that § 302 (c) of the Revenue Act of 19261 as amended by the Joint Resolution of Congress of March 3, 1931,2 and § 803 (a) of the Revenue Act of 1932,3 includes in the gross estate of a decedent, for estate tax, property which, before the adoption...
